Technical Specifications
Parameters and characteristics commom to parts in this series
Specification | JAN1N4492US | 1N4492 Series |
---|---|---|
- | - | |
Current - Reverse Leakage @ Vr | 250 nA | 250 nA |
Grade | Military | Military |
Impedance (Max) (Zzt) [Max] | 500 Ohms | 500 Ohms |
Mounting Type | Surface Mount | Surface Mount, Through Hole |
Operating Temperature [Max] | 347 °F | 175 - 347 °F |
Operating Temperature [Min] | -65 ░C | -65 ░C |
Package / Case | - | DO-204AL, DO-41, Axial |
Power - Max [Max] | 1.5 W | 1.5 W |
Qualification | MIL-PRF-19500/406 | MIL-PRF-19500/406 |
Supplier Device Package | D-5A | D-5A, DO-41, DO-204AL (DO-41), A, SQ-MELF |
Tolerance | 5 % | 2 - 5 % |
Voltage - Forward (Vf) (Max) @ If | 1 V | 1 V |
Voltage - Zener (Nom) (Vz) | 130 V | 130 V |
